Did you know that every state has a program for free eye and vision assessments with an optometrist for infants between 6 and 12 months? This program is called InfantSEE and is a no-cost program managed by the AOA, the American Optometric Association, through their...

The American Society for Deaf Children has compiled a great list of holiday stories in ASL. Some of the stories are probably known to you while others may be new. Check them all out with your child and family and add some sign language into your holiday season.
